Output ef95880d543481acdee88380eedc4a625843bf9d5b56de8545082cfccdc0015d:70

value
43927
script pubkey
OP_0 OP_PUSHBYTES_20 8fe874277481325ca2f5c33ab3ce2251d9316181
address
bc1q3l58gfm5sye9egh4cvat8n3z28vnzcvpuk96ht
transaction
ef95880d543481acdee88380eedc4a625843bf9d5b56de8545082cfccdc0015d
spent
true